Cow eye infections, commonly referred to as conjunctivitis or pinkeye, can occur in both calves and adult cattle, though younger animals are often more susceptible due to their developing immune systems. The condition is characterized by inflammation of the conjunctiva— the membrane that covers the white part of the eye and inner eyelids— and can result in symptoms such as redness, excessive tearing, squinting, and in severe cases, eye discharge. Infected cattle may also experience discomfort, leading to behavioral changes such as reduced feed intake and general lethargy.

Quaternary ammonium compounds (quats) are also widely used in veterinary practices. These disinfectants are effective against gram-positive bacteria and have some activity against viruses. Quats are often found in surface disinfectants that are used to clean cages, kennels, and other areas where animals are housed. However, they are less effective against gram-negative bacteria and certain viruses, which means they may not be suitable for all disinfection needs. It is crucial to follow the manufacturer's instructions for dilution and contact time to achieve the desired disinfection level.

2. Ondansetron Originally developed for humans undergoing chemotherapy, ondansetron can also be effective for dogs. It works by blocking serotonin receptors in the brain that lead to nausea and vomiting. This medication is typically used in more severe cases, such as after surgery or during chemotherapy.

These types of manholes are about two to three feet or 75-90 centimeters of shallow depth. They are normally placed at the starting of a sewer or drainage water conduit passage and in the areas that are not subjected to heavy traffic. These types are suitable for maintenance work and are also known as inspection chambers with a light lid as a cover at its end.

Retractable bollards are vertically movable posts that can be raised or lowered to manage vehicle access. Unlike fixed bollards, which serve as permanent barriers, retractable bollards allow you to control access on demand. When not in use, they can be retracted into the ground, allowing for clear passage. This feature makes them versatile for areas that require flexible usage, such as pedestrian zones that may occasionally need vehicle access for deliveries or emergency services.

In addition to flood prevention, storm drain covers play a vital role in protecting water quality. When rainwater flows over urban surfaces, it often picks up contaminants like oil, debris, and chemicals. These pollutants can enter the waterways through storm drains, harming ecosystems and drinking water supplies. Effective covers help filter out large debris, while modern systems are designed to capture smaller pollutants, reducing the impact on the local watershed.

2. Hanging Racks These racks support the bikes by the top frame, usually at two or three points. While they tend to be lighter and often less expensive than platform racks, they may require a little more care when loading, as they rely on the bike's frame for support. Hanging racks can be a good option for standard road bikes and hybrids.
